Mission

THE COMMUNITY CATALYST ACTION FUND (CCAF) IS COMMITTED TO ENSURING CONSUMERS ARE ACTIVELY ENGAGED IN THE DECISION-MAKING THAT SHAPES OUR HEALTH AND HEALTH SYSTEM.THAT MEANS INFLUENCING OR CHANGING THE LANDSCAPE TO MAKE ACCESS TO COMPREHENSIVE HEALTH CARE A CENTRAL TENET OF POLICYMAKING AND CREATING OPPORTUNITIES FOR CONSUMERS TO PARTICIPATE FULLY AND DIRECTLY IN THE CREATION AND IMPLEMENTATION OF LAWS AFFECTING THEIR ACCESS TO QUALITY CARE.WE ELECT CANDIDATES WHO WILL RELENTLESSLY PROTECT AND CHAMPION ACCESS TO QUALITY, AFFORDABLE CARE AND GET INVOLVED IN EFFORTS THAT CENTER HEALTH CARE AND JUSTICE IN POLICY AND DECISION MAKING.
